The Panduit FW2RLU1U1ONM030 delivers 30-meter reach for OM5 multimode trunk runs in datacenters migrating to 400GBASE-SR4.1 and 800GBASE-SR8. The LC duplex uniboot design cuts patch-panel density requirements by 50% versus traditional duplex LC—critical when you're running eight parallel lanes per 400G port and cabinet space is maxed. Factory-optimized insertion loss keeps channel budgets predictable across 850/950 nm SWDM wavelengths, and the 2 mm reduced-diameter LSZH jacket simplifies cable management in overhead trays and raised-floor conduits. Lime green OM5 color coding ensures instant visual identification during MACs and helps prevent accidental cross-patching to OM3/OM4 legacy infrastructure.
OM5 wideband multimode fiber uses a laser-optimized 50 μm core with controlled effective modal bandwidth (EMB) across four SWDM wavelengths, enabling short-wavelength division multiplexing for 400G/800G Ethernet without parallel-fiber lane multiplication. Where 400GBASE-SR16 demands sixteen fiber pairs and bulky MPO-32 connectors, 400GBASE-SR4.1 achieves the same data rate over a single duplex LC pair using SWDM optics—cutting fiber count by 93% and allowing migration to 400G within existing LC infrastructure. The FW2RLU1U1ONM030's factory-optimized insertion loss spec ensures each wavelength channel (850/880/910/940 nm) stays within the 1.5 dB attenuation budget required by IEEE 802.3bs, and Panduit's controlled fiber geometry minimizes differential mode delay (DMD) to keep bit error rates below 10⁻¹² even at the far end of a 150-meter channel. The LC uniboot termination uses a single compact boot housing with internally routed transmit and receive fibers, eliminating the dual-boot keying tabs that snag on adjacent cables during dense patch-panel installs. UPC (ultra-physical-contact) polish on both connectors delivers ≤-50 dB return loss and ≤0.3 dB insertion loss per mating, with a convex 5-25 mm radius end-face that maintains physical contact under vibration and thermal cycling. The 2 mm cable diameter (versus 3 mm standard duplex LC) cuts cross-sectional area by 56%, allowing you to route 30% more circuits through the same 4-inch ladder rack or 2-inch conduit—a measurable advantage when retrofitting 400G into legacy datacenters where pathway fill is already at NEC 40% limits.
This 30-meter length targets three common datacenter topologies: intra-row connections from server to top-of-rack (TOR) switch (typical run 5-25m depending on rack height and overhead/underfloor routing), cross-aisle horizontal runs between adjacent rows (15-30m), and short end-of-row (EOR) aggregation links where spine switches sit within the same hot/cold aisle pod. In a leaf-spine Clos fabric, each compute server typically homes to its local TOR with a short OM5 jumper (3-5m), and each TOR uplinks to two spine switches with slightly longer runs—this 30m length handles the spine uplink when switches are positioned at opposite ends of a 12-rack row. The lime green jacket provides instant visual confirmation during MAC operations: aqua cables are OM3 (10G-300m / 40G-100m), erika violet is OM4 (10G-550m / 40G-150m / 100G-150m), and lime is OM5 (10G-550m / 40G-150m / 100G-150m / 400G-150m with SWDM). Accidentally patching a 400GBASE-SR4.1 transceiver into an OM3 cable will either fail link negotiation or produce error bursts under load—color coding prevents the mistake before it reaches production. The LSZH jacket meets IEC 60332-1-2 flame propagation limits and produces low smoke and zero halogen gases during combustion, satisfying European EN 50575 CPR (Construction Products Regulation) Class B2ca and increasingly common US datacenter specs that prohibit PVC in overhead air-handling spaces. Standard polarity (connector A transmits to connector B receive, and vice versa) aligns with TIA-568 structured cabling conventions and allows you to use this jumper as a direct drop-in for any duplex LC port without polarity adapters or gender changers. When deploying alongside MPO trunk cables (e.g., 24-fiber MPO backbone with breakout cassettes), the uniboot LC form factor fits the same patch-panel footprint as the cassette's LC adapters, maintaining port density and airflow clearances.
Panduit's Opti-Core fiber product line undergoes end-face inspection and insertion-loss validation at the factory, with each connector meeting IEC 61300-3-35 geometry specs (radius of curvature 5-25 mm, apex offset ≤50 μm, fiber undercut 0-150 nm) and TIA-568.3-D attenuation limits (≤0.5 dB max, ≤0.3 dB typical) before leaving the facility. This factory QA eliminates the field polish variability and contamination risk that plague bulk-fiber terminations, and it guarantees you'll hit your channel insertion-loss budget on the first install—no do-overs, no blame-shifting between fiber vendor and transceiver vendor when a link won't train. The uniboot's integrated pull-tab release allows single-handed connector removal even in fully populated 144-port panels, and the push-pull latch (versus the older squeeze-tab design) survives 500+ mating cycles without latch fatigue or accidental disconnects during adjacent-port access. For datacenter operators staging 400G/800G Ethernet migrations on a row-by-row or pod-by-pod schedule, this 30-meter OM5 jumper provides a future-proof LC infrastructure investment: it supports today's 10G/25G/100G transceivers at full distance, tomorrow's 400G SWDM optics at 150m, and the forthcoming 800G SWDM specs at 100m—all over the same duplex LC footprint your team already knows how to install, test, and maintain.
